Kopran assigns 3 brands, inhaler design to Merck

Our Bureau

Mumbai , June 21

KOPRAN Ltd has entered into an alliance with Merck Specialities Pvt Ltd. It has assigned its brands Vent, Tini and Bid's range of products and inhaler design to Merck.

Vent is an anti-asthmatic product, Tini is for gastrointestinal problems and Bid is an antibiotic. The total consideration of the deal is Rs 20 crore and it will include the transfer of technology by Kopran for the manufacture of finished dosage forms.
